Paul Reuschel was a professional baseball P who played from 1975 to 1979. Reuschel played 198 games in the major leagues, hitting 0.063 with 0 home runs. A right-handed, Reuschel stood 6'4" tall and brought athleticism and dedication to his position. Born in Quincy, IL, Reuschel made significant contributions to baseball.
